@AIBot Can you discuss the concept of “cross-layer” or “layer 2” solutions and their role in addressing scalability issues in blockchain networks?
Certainly! Cross-layer or layer 2 solutions refer to various techniques and protocols designed to address scalability issues in blockchain networks. These solutions aim to improve the transaction throughput and efficiency of blockchain systems without modifying the underlying blockchain protocol.
The term “layer 2” is derived from the protocol stack model, where the blockchain protocol operates at the base or layer 1. Layer 2 solutions build on top of the base layer and leverage its security guarantees. They are often implemented as off-chain solutions, meaning that some transactions or operations are performed outside the primary blockchain, while still being anchored to it.
One popular layer 2 solution is the Lightning Network, primarily used in Bitcoin. It enables fast and low-cost micropayments by creating off-chain payment channels between users. These channels allow multiple transactions to occur without them being recorded on the blockchain until they are settled on-chain.
Other layer 2 solutions include state channels, sidechains, and plasma chains. They provide scalability by reducing the number of transactions recorded